Why Bamridan-gil?
Bamridan-gil, nestled in Ilsan’s bustling Jungang-dong district, has acquired its name as the go-to vacation spot for locals trying to get great foods and drinks. Contrary to Seoul’s crowded nightlife hotspots, Bamridan-gil strikes a equilibrium in between Vitality and intimacy, which makes it ideal for close friends who would like to chat, chortle, and savor high-quality time with no chaos. The region is especially popular for its:

Various dining choices: From hofs (Korean-design pubs) to izakayas and themed bars.
Reasonably priced charges: Foods and drinks are wallet-pleasant when compared with central Seoul.
Regional vibe: Most spots are operate by long-time people, making sure reliable flavors and hospitality.

Simple Tips
Obtaining There: Get Seoul Metro Line 3 to Jeongbalsan Station (Exit 3). Bamridan-gil is a 10-minute wander.
Best Time to go to: Weekdays after 7 PM for a energetic-but-not-packed vibe; weekends get crowded by eight PM.
Spending plan: ₩thirty,000–₩50,000 for each particular person (which includes foods and drinks).
